// METRICS_FLUSH_INTERVAL_MS
//
// Flush cadence for the Grayspur aggregation sidecar. New folks:
// do not lower this below 5000. The sidecar batches counters
// per-pod and the collector rate-limits hard; faster flushes get
// dropped silently and dashboards lie. Raised from 2000 after the
// Q3 incident. If you change it, rebuild the sidecar image and
// note the change in the runbook. The pinned build token follows.

session token of tajog-fahaf = htk21_4ae55819f45410afcb307

### Account Recovery — Catalogue Import (Lintwood)

Quick one for review: when the Lintwood catalogue import wipes a patron's session table, the recovery flow re-seeds accounts from the nightly snapshot. Check that the importer skips locked accounts — last time it didn't. To rerun recovery against staging you'll need the vault passphrase, which is appended just below.

recovery phrase for yafof-tajof: julmir-kelax-julvan-holath-belvan-holir-ralael-ralvan-ralath-julvan-silmir-istmir-kaswyn-ulamir

Test plan for the Marrowline broker upgrade (v4 to v5): drain one shard, replay a day of captured traffic, and verify zero message reordering and stable consumer lag. Rollback criteria: lag above 30s for five minutes. Pulling replay captures from the Dunmere archive API requires the bearer token below.

session JWT of yawep-yawep = eyJhbGciOiJIUzI1NiIsInR5cCI6IkpXVCJ9.eyJzdWIiOiI3pWF3_In0.aXYsHiog

Hey — welcome aboard! The orphaned-resource sweeper (we call it Tidyhawk) runs nightly and deletes volumes, snapshots, and stray load balancers with no owner tag. Dry-run mode is on in staging; prod is live, so be careful with the allowlist in sweeper.yaml. Gustavo left notes in the Brambleton wiki. The sweeper's credentials sit in a sealed vault — unseal it with the recovery passphrase below.

unlock words, yagep-fahof: belix-rusvan-casdor-gorox-aldath-norael-istix-quenael-fraeth-silael